Methodology

How WhoNailedIt scores public calls.

WhoNailedIt tracks public macro predictions, keeps the source attached, and scores only calls that have enough evidence to evaluate. The goal is a useful accountability record, not investment advice.

How it works

From source to score.

The same workflow behind the public scoreboards, adapted here to show what counts, what waits, and what stays out of the denominator.

Source

Preserve the source

Public interviews and videos are monitored, queued, and preserved with the original source attached.

Extract

Pull out the calls

Specific predictions are timestamped and mapped to speakers, topics, assets, regions, and timeframes.

Verify

Check against reality

Resolved calls are checked against public evidence and market data when the outcome can be evaluated.

Score

Average the record

Final verdicts become points, then points are averaged across people, videos, topics, and themes.

Accuracy Formula

Accuracy is calculated as total scored points divided by the number of resolved predictions. Open, pending, queued, unverified, unverifiable, and verifier-error states are excluded.

VerdictPointsMeaning
Correct1.00The forecast clearly happened.
Mostly Correct0.75The core call was right, with material caveats.
Partially Correct0.50The call was directionally or conditionally right, but incomplete.
Mostly Wrong0.00The call missed in the important ways.
Wrong0.00The forecast clearly did not happen.

Corrections

Scoring can be revised when better evidence, context, or source material is found. To flag an issue, send the prediction link and the source material to [email protected].
